Chief Executive John Lee said on Monday that quarantine-free travel will resume very soon in a gradual, orderly and safe manner.
Writing in the Ta Kung Pao newspaper, he said authorities would take into consideration the Covid situation on both sides of the border, formulate plans and strike a good balance.
He said the re-opening of the border would boost Hong Kong's economy, adding that the new year would be a prosperous one.
"We will strike a balance between meeting people's demand for quarantine-free travel and keeping it orderly and safe," he wrote. "We will achieve target of full reopening of the border in a gradual and orderly manner as soon as possible to boost Hong Kong's economy."
Summing up his work visit to Beijing last week, the CE said the SAR goverment would focus on three priorities as the city is at a crucial stage of advancing to prosperity.
Firstly, he said Hong Kong must grasp the opportunities offered by the country and integrate into China's national development.
Secondly, he stressed that Hong Kong should make good use of the advantages of the One Country Two Systems principle.
Thirdly, he reiterated that the government would attract and nurture talent to ensure Hong Kong's continued competitiveness.
